Researchers at Johns Hopkins University are working to
provide a sense of touch to surgeons using robots.
Doctors need to feel the needle puncturing tissue, tension
on a suture, and the texture of a calcification.
One possibility is to provide touch feedback in the form of
color on a monitor.
